David Bateson (born February 9, 1960) is an English actor. He is famous for being the voice of Agent 47. This character is the main hero in the Hitman video game series. David has voiced Agent 47 in all eight main games since 2000. He has both British and Danish citizenship.

Early Life and Moving Around
David Bateson was born in Durban, South Africa, on February 9, 1960. His parents were English. He grew up moving a lot between South Africa and England. He once said his family moved at least 13 times! He went to nine different schools. This made him feel a bit unsure about where he truly belonged for a while.
Becoming an Actor
David Bateson started his acting career in 1994. His first role was Hother in a film called Prince of Jutland. He also appeared in the 1996 movie Breaking the Waves. In 2002, he played the main role in a short film called Debutanten.
Voicing Agent 47
David Bateson's most well-known role is providing the voice for Agent 47. Agent 47 is the main character in the popular Hitman video game series. These games are known as stealth games, where players try to complete missions without being seen. David has not only voiced Agent 47 but also performed the motion capture for the character. This means his movements were recorded and used for the character's actions in the game.
Many fans thought Agent 47's look was based on David. However, David has said this is just a coincidence. He looks a lot like the character, but it wasn't planned!
There was a time when David was replaced for the game Hitman: Absolution. Fans were very upset about this. David later shared that he was "unceremoniously dropped" from the series. But luckily, he was hired back to voice Agent 47 before the game came out. Another actor did the motion capture for that game. David continued to voice Agent 47 in later Hitman games, including Hitman, Hitman 2, and Hitman 3.
Other Voice Roles
Besides Hitman, David Bateson has lent his voice to other projects. In 2020, he voiced a character named Virgil in an indie game called Lightmatter. This was his first video game voice role outside of the Hitman series.
He also voiced a very famous character in the Danish version of a movie! David was the voice of Bowser in the Danish dub of The Super Mario Bros. Movie in 2023. This means he voiced the same lines that Jack Black said in the original English version. David has also worked on many Danish TV shows and narrated various commercials for Lego.
Life in Denmark
David Bateson has lived in different countries, including Canada, England, and South Africa. For a long time now, he has lived in Copenhagen, Denmark. He is a Danish citizen and speaks Danish very well. He is a member of both the British and Danish actors' unions.
